What Key Factors Should You Look for in an IT Provider?
1. How Fast Are Their Response Times?
You need an IT provider that guarantees rapid response times and offers 24/7/365 availability. As of 2026, Gartner found that the average cost of downtime per minute is $5600. With costs like this, you simply can't afford to waste time waiting for an unresponsive IT provider.
Always ask for documented service level agreements (SLAs) that guarantee a quick response.
2. Do They Offer Proactive Monitoring?
Proactive monitoring is the continuous tracking of your network to detect and resolve issues before they become big problems. This preventative maintenance approach is key to the smooth running of your daily operations.
Preventative maintenance saves you money on emergency repairs and is a major green flag for effective IT services for small businesses.
3. What Are Their Cybersecurity Capabilities?
Look for IT services for small businesses that include endpoint protection, advanced threat detection, and strong email security. Cyber threats are constantly evolving, making small businesses prime targets for ransomware and data breaches. In the first quarter of 2026 alone, there were 264 publicly disclosed ransomware attacks across a range of industries.
Endpoint protection secures individual devices like laptops and smartphones from malicious software. A provider with these strong security measures can protect your sensitive business data from hackers.
4. Do They Have Relevant Industry Experience?
Your IT provider should have experience working within your particular industry, especially in sectors like healthcare, legal, and finance that have strict regulatory compliance requirements.
Familiarity with your industry means the provider already knows how your industry's workflows and software operate. With an IT provider for small businesses, niche expertise is needed for faster troubleshooting and avoiding compliance violations.
5. When Can They Provide Local, On-Site Support?
A provider that can deploy local technicians and offer on-site availability is invaluable for fixing hardware failures and complex network problems. If the IT provider you are researching cannot provide on-site support, then you should continue looking.
Some problems can be solved remotely, but in the instances when they can't, a local presence guarantees faster issue resolution. This minimizes disruptions and gets your office up and running again quickly.
What Should You Ask Potential IT Providers?
-
What is your average response time for critical emergencies?
-
Do you offer 24/7 support every day of the year?
-
What specific cybersecurity measures do you include in your standard plan?
-
How do you handle data backups and disaster recovery planning?
-
Can you fully support my industry’s specific regulatory compliance requirements?
Use these questions to evaluate any provider of IT services for small businesses. This will prevent you from signing a contract with an underperforming vendor.

Frequently Asked Questions About IT Services:
What are IT services for small businesses?
IT services for small businesses are the professional management of a company's technology infrastructure. This includes network maintenance, cybersecurity protection, data backups, and daily helpdesk support.
Why is proactive IT support better than the break-fix model?
Proactive support fixes vulnerabilities before they cause system failures, whereas the break-fix model waits for equipment to break down before fixing it.
